Thorough Repair Completed On Cooperstown Post Office Steps COOPERSTOWN – Regular patrons at Cooperstown’s post office, across from the Hall of Fame, were met with a treat when they checked postal boxes this morning:  The front steps, long patched and uneven, were almost as good as new. Yesterday afternoon, a crew from Mattoon Construction, Liverpool, completed what amounted to almost a reconstruction of the well-used entryway.   In contrast to short-lived patching of recent years, the Mattoon crew cut the individual treds back…
